DOI QR코드

DOI QR Code

A Technique Getting Fast Masks Using Rough Division in Dynamic ROI Coding of JPEG2000

JPEG2000의 동적 ROI 코딩에서 개략적인 분할을 이용한 빠른 마스크 생성 기법

  • 박재흥 (경상대학교 컴퓨터과학과) ;
  • 이점숙 (경상대학교 컴퓨터과학과) ;
  • 서영건 (경상대학교 컴퓨터교육과, 컴정연구소원) ;
  • 홍도순 (경상대학교 컴퓨터과학과) ;
  • 김현주 (진주산업대학교 컴퓨터공학과)
  • Received : 2010.08.17
  • Accepted : 2010.10.15
  • Published : 2010.12.31

Abstract

It takes a long time for the users to view a whole image from the image server under the low-bandwidth internet environments or in case of a big sized image. In this case, as there needs a technique that preferentially transfers a part of image, JPEG2000 offers a ROI(Region-of-Interest) coding. In ROI coding, the users see the thumbnail of image from the server and specifies some regions that they want to see first. And then if an information about the regions are informed to the server, the server preferentially transfers the regions of the image. The existing methods requested a huge time to compute the mask information, but this thesis approximately computes the regions and reduces the creating time of the ROI masks. If each code block is a mixed block which ROI and background are mixed, the proper boundary points should be acquired. Searching the edges of the block, getting the two points on the edge, to get the boundary point inside the code block, the method searches a mid point between the two edge points. The proposed method doesn't have a big difference compared to the existing methods in quality, but the processing time is more speedy than the ones.

인터넷이 느린 환경이나 이미지가 큰 경우에 서버로부터 이미지를 전부 보는 데는 시간이 걸린다. 이를 위해, 이미지의 일부를 우선적으로 처리하는 방법이 필요하여, JPEG2000에서는 ROI(Region-of-Interest) 코딩으로 제공하고 있다. ROI 코딩은 이미지의 thumbnail을 사용자에게 보내어 개략적인 이미지를 보고 먼저 보고 싶어 하는 영역을 지정하면, 이 영역에 관한 정보가 서버로 전달되어, 서버는 사용자에게 이 영역을 우선적으로 전송한다. 이를 처리하기 위해, 기존의 방법은 사용자가 지정한 영역을 계산할 때, 섬세하게 계산을 함으로써 영역에 관한 마스크 정보 생성 시간을 많이 요구하였는데, 본 연구에서 제안하는 방법은 개략적으로 영역을 계산하고, ROI 마스크의 생성시간을 줄이는 방법을 제안한다. 각 블록에서 ROI와 배경이 섞여 있는 블록이면 적절한 경계선을 찾기 위하여 코드블록의 가장자리를 이진 탐색하여 두 경계지점을 얻고, 두 점 간의 중간에 위치한 코드블록 내의 경계점을 얻기 위하여, 두 점 간의 중간 지점을 이진 탐색한다. 이렇게 얻어진 세 점을 지나는 두 직선의 방정식을 이용해서 개략적인 ROI 코딩을 한다. 제안한 방법은 품질 면에서는 큰 차이가 없지만 실행 속도 면에서는 현저하게 빠르다는 것을 보인다.

Keywords

References

  1. Y. Shujjing, G. Yanfeng and Z. Ye, “An Automatic ROI Coding Algorihtm Based on Multi-Resolution Target Detection”, ISSCAA 2nd Int'l Symposium on Digital Object Identification, pp.1-4, 2008. https://doi.org/10.1109/ISSCAA.2008.4776248
  2. 강기준 외, “JPEG2000 이미지에서 적응적 코드블록 판별 알고리즘을 이용한 동적 고속 관심영역 코딩 방법”, 한국정보처리학회 논문지 B, 제14-B권, 5호, pp. 321-328, 2007.10. https://doi.org/10.3745/KIPSTB.2007.14-B.5.321
  3. J. Hara, “An Implementation of JPEG 2000 Interactive Image Communication System”, ISCAS 2005, Vol.6, pp.5922-5925, May 2005. https://doi.org/10.1109/ISCAS.2005.1465987
  4. J. In, S. Shirani, and F. Kossentini, “On RD Optimized Processive Image Coding Using JPEG", IEEE Transactions on Image Processing, Vol.8, No.11, pp.1630-1638, Nov. 1999. https://doi.org/10.1109/83.799890
  5. Ahn, C. B., Kim, I. Y. and Han, S. W., “Medical Image Compression Using JPEG Progressive Coding”, Nuclear Science Symposium and Medical Imaging Conference, 1993 IEEE Conference Record, pp.1336-1339, Nov. 1993. https://doi.org/10.1109/NSSMIC.1993.701857
  6. ISO/IEC International Standard 15444-1, ITU Recommendation T.800, “JPEG2000 Image Coding System”, 2000.
  7. C. Christopoulos, A. Skodras and T. Ebrahimi, "The JPEG2000 Still Image Coding System : An Overview", IEEE Transactions on Consumer Electronics, Vol. 46, No. 4, pp.1103-1127, Nov. 2000. https://doi.org/10.1109/30.920468
  8. Kong H-S, Vetro A., Hata T. and Kuwahara N., “Fast Region-of-Interest Transcoding for JPEG2000 Images”, Mitsubishi Electric Reseerch Laboratories, Inc., Dec. 2005.
  9. M. Boliek and C. Christopoulos, “JPEG 2000 Part Ⅰ Final Committee Draft Version 1.0", ISO/IEC JTC 1/SC 29/WG 1 N1646R, March 2000.
  10. M. Boliek, E. Majani, J. S. Houchin, J. Kasner and M. L. Carlander, “JPEG 2000 Part II Final Committee Draft", ISO/IEC JTC 1/SC 29/WG 1 N2000, Dec. 2000.
  11. 박순화 외 4명, “관심영역 코딩을 위한 기울기 정보기반의 빠른 마스크 생성 기법”, 한국컴퓨터정보학회 논문지, 제14권, 제1호, pp.81-89, 2009.
  12. 박재흥 외 4명, “JPEG2000에서 ROI의 자동 추출과 우선적 처리”, 한국컴퓨터정보학회 논문지, 제14권, 제6호, pp.127-136, 2008.
  13. P. G. Tahoees, J. R. Varela, M. J. Lado and M. Souto, "Image Compression : Maxshift ROI encoding options in JPEG2000", Computer Vision and Image Understanding, Vol.109, Iss. 2, pp.139-145, 2008. https://doi.org/10.1016/j.cviu.2007.07.001